

A 1952 graduate of Chaminade High School, Don soon met the love of his life, Madonna, after crashing the wedding of her best friend. That chance encounter began a beautiful love story and 69 years of marriage — the joy and foundation of his life. Don was a loving and devoted hus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ather, and friend.
Don was a member of St. Helen Parish, where he proudly ran the Main Booth and Raffle at the parish festival for more than 60 years. He also served as an usher for many years.
Since 1987, Don was the owner and operator of Mr. Hipp in Fairborn, where he built many lifelong friendships.
He enjoyed cheering on the Cincinnati Reds and Cincinnati Bengals, playing golf, watering his flowers, feeding his birds, and soaking up the sunshine from his chair in the driveway. Don was witty, loyal, and a true “funny guy” who especially enjoyed gathering with family and friends on Fridays at Bunny’s Hasty Tasty — a place filled with fond memories and familiar faces.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Lawrence and Emreda Hilgeford; his son, Dennis Hilgeford; his granddaughter, Stefanie Moran; his son-in-law, Matt Moran; his brother, Paul Hilgeford; and his sister, Carolyn Hilgeford.
Those left to cherish Don’s memory include his beloved wife, Madonna Hilgeford; his children, Denise Moran, Dina (Dan) Byrnes, Darla (Mike) Donohue, Devon Madsen, Drew (Mindy) Hilgeford, and Clifford Madsen; grandchildren, Dannah (Ernie) Vardaman, Matthew (Anna) Moran, Michael (Courtney) Donohue, Sean (Kelly) Donohue, Molly Donohue, Casey Byrnes, Maggie (Erik) Schneider, Jack Byrnes, Alex Hilgeford, Eric Hilgeford, and Kate Hilgeford; great-grandchildren Manuel and Benita Moran; Isla and Dominic Donohue; Murphy and Luke Donohue; and Dani and Lucas Schneider. Don is further survived by his brother, Jim (Celia) Hilgeford, and his sister, Marilyn Fischer.
The family extends their heartfelt gratitude to Hospice of Dayton for their compassionate and loving care during Don’s final weeks.
Don loved life, and he was deeply loved by his family and friends.
